    Abstract: A system and method are described for the production of color selection swatch cards for point of purchase displays of custom blended paints, textiles or plastics using a digital inkjet printer and custom blended inkjet inks based on a set of base inks that can be blended using commercial match prediction software. The base inks are matched spectrally to the base paints, dyes or plastics.

    Abstract: A dissolvable produce washing label includes a dissolvable facestock impregnated with a produce cleanser; an adhesive layer; and a coating to seal and protect from water and humidity. When rubbed and washed with water by the end user the top coating wears and breaks to expose the dissolvable substrate, thereby dissolving the facestock and releasing the produce wash.

    Abstract: A three dimensional printed article (10) having a composite image (110) printed thereon is disclosed. The composite image includes top and bottom artwork portions (210, 310) printed on the top and bottom surfaces (200, 300) of the printed article substrate (100). Both artwork portions are visible through a translucent or transparent substrate, thereby forming a visible composite image. The substrate can be a non-woven web. By printing on both surfaces of the substrate, the three dimensional printed article provides a good quality, aesthetically pleasing three-dimensional image that limits the loss of color and appearance of fuzz during normal use of the article. The three-dimensional printed article allows a more versatile creation of process colors and reduces the number of spot colors required to print the composite image. The three-dimensional printed article can be integrated into an absorbent article (12), such as a diaper. A method of printing the three- dimensional printed article and forming the absorbent article are also disclosed.

    Abstract: A method of forming a sheet of material with indicia thereon comprises applying indicia to the sheet by an electrostatic copying process in which a toner powder is deposited on the sheet and is heated to cause it to fuse. The sheet of material comprises a flexible support layer that is provided with a porous coating of a latent curable material, preferably in particulate and/or filamentary form and especially one based on an epoxy material. It has been found that the indicia are more indelible than those formed on other surfaces by the same process even though the fused toner is not absorbed by the curable material.

    Abstract: A drug delivery device includes a housing, a reservoir, a cannula, one or more light sources, a label, and a controller. The reservoir is disposed within the housing. The cannula is connected to the reservoir for delivering a drug from the reservoir to the patient. The light sources are disposed adjacent the exterior surface of the housing, and each serves to indicate one of one or more operational conditions of the device. The label is fixed to the housing adjacent the light sources, and includes one or more informational messages. Each informational message is aligned with one of the light sources for conveniently conveying to a user an operational condition of the device as indicated by the corresponding light source. Finally, the controller is operably connected to the reservoir and the light sources. The controller is configured to actuate the reservoir to deliver the drug, and to selectively illuminate the one or more light sources based on the operational condition of the drug delivery device.

    Abstract: A method of manufacturing a roll of adhesive labels. The method includes the step of providing a plurality of adhesive labels fixed to a backing sheet. A predetermined number of labels are removed from the backing sheet to thereby form a leading edge of the sheet that only includes the backing sheet and no labels. The leading edge includes no labels to thereby facilitate mounting the sheet of carrier material on a printing or applicator machine.

    Abstract: A bag includes a flexible web that is shaped into the shape of a bag and a communication member attached to the flexible web with an adhesive. When the communication member is removed from the web, substantially no adhesive remains on the web. An advertising medium includes a packaging material made of a first material and a communication member applied to the packaging material. The communication member has a first part that is positioned directly adjacent the packaging material and a second part positioned on the first part that is made of the same material or a different material as the first part. One or both of the first part and second part are removable from the packaging material without substantially marring the surface of the packaging material.
